Макрос на @die Если попал на совсем левую локу.

Общие вопросы по OpenKore обсуждаются здесь. Можно сказать, что это - основной раздел форума.
Возник вопрос? Вам сюда.

Модератор: 4epT

Правила форума
Все вопросы по OK не касающиеся плагинов и макросов публикуются в этом разделе.
Перед тем как что то писать, пожалуйста, удостоверьтесь что данная тема не поднималась, вы полностью изучили мануалы по конфигурационным файлам бота и не нашли там решения.
Lolo
Начинающий
Сообщения: 32
Зарегистрирован: Ср май 21, 2008 9:20 pm

Макрос на @die Если попал на совсем левую локу.

Сообщение Lolo »

Помогите пожалуйста с макросом..
Наверн одна из самых главных проблемм на Хай рейтах где боты разрешены
Если оставить толпень ботов на ночь то может вот что произойти: 1 человек валит ботов а второй(прист,чамп) ставит варп на респ и все боты попадают на локу откуда бот сам дойти не сможет...от чего он просто стоит и пытается найти дорогу к Локе..но это у него не получается( потому все время в консоле пишет что то на подобии этого(раз 10 в сек) "Невозможно найти путь к cmd_fild01"..из за этого проц грузиться на 100% и боты стоят всю ночь на месте

так вот..Напишите пожалуйста макрос который будет писать в консоль @die (=бот умирает и отправляется на сейв поинт) если он окажется не на comodo=>beach_dun03=>cmd_fild01 (бот передвигается только по этим локам)

(Варпатся от игроков не хочу. ибо на локе столько ботов что все мои бесконечно варпаются >_<)

Заранее благодарен :cry:
Retro
Энтузиаст
Сообщения: 53
Зарегистрирован: Чт янв 31, 2008 1:30 am

Сообщение Retro »

А самому покурить маны по макро плагину не дано? Если нет, то тебе в сервис. Мог бы и сам найти, поиск рулит.

А лично я думаю что будет типа такого:

Код: Выделить всё

automacro die {
location not comodo, beach_dun03, cmd_fild01
call die1
run-once 1
}

macro die {
do c "@die"
pause 1
release die
}
Не бейте сильно, если знающие люди найдут ошибку, я просто недавно начал макроплагин курить :)
Не пинайте нуба ногами
Аватара пользователя
4epT
macro-маньячина
Сообщения: 2792
Зарегистрирован: Чт дек 21, 2006 1:23 pm
Сервер RO:: 4game
Discord: ya4ept#8494
Контактная информация:

Сообщение 4epT »

перенесите в раздел макросов + темку измените по стандарту
Быстро и качественно напишу конфиг (макрос)! Стучи!
¤ Свежий бот ¤ Config checker ¤ Manual ¤
Изображение
Изображение
Lolo
Начинающий
Сообщения: 32
Зарегистрирован: Ср май 21, 2008 9:20 pm

Сообщение Lolo »

Спасибо работает ^_^

После первого запуска выдало ошибку "Automacro die1 not found"
Убрал кавычки "@die" и добавил единицу в macro die1 { и он заработал ) Огромное спасибо

Код: Выделить всё

automacro die {
location not comodo, beach_dun03, cmd_fild01
call die1
run-once 1
}

macro die1 {
do c @die
pause 1
release die
}
:twisted:
Lolo
Начинающий
Сообщения: 32
Зарегистрирован: Ср май 21, 2008 9:20 pm

Сообщение Lolo »

Как то странно он себя ведет... Как только он переходит из Comodo в Beach_dun 03 то срабатывает макрос die1 >_< даж хз как оно лечиться (

Код: Выделить всё

NPC Exists: Comodo Guide#cmd (322, 178) (ID 110015032) - (0)
Portal Exists: comodo -> beach_dun3 (332, 175) - (0)
Map Change: beach_dun3.gat (23, 260)
[macro] automacro die triggered.
PvP Display Mode
Portal Exists: beach_dun3 -> comodo (17, 265) - (0)
[macro] automacro die triggered.
Item Appeared: Skull (0) x 1 (23, 261)
Sound alert: death
You have died
You've died.
Аватара пользователя
Kissa2k
Профессионал
Сообщения: 1304
Зарегистрирован: Пн дек 04, 2006 8:33 pm

Сообщение Kissa2k »

Lolo
Смотри, у тебя в макросе написано beach_dun03, а локация называется beach_dun3.
Lolo
Начинающий
Сообщения: 32
Зарегистрирован: Ср май 21, 2008 9:20 pm

Сообщение Lolo »

Все равно не помогает ><

Код: Выделить всё

location not comodo, beach_dun03, cmd_fild01, comodo.gat, beach_dun03.gat, cmd_fild01.gat, beach_dun3.
он сдыхает при входе в игру и при переходи с комодо на бич_данж03 а потом почему-то все нормально..это оч напрягает (
Artemyi
Энтузиаст
Сообщения: 61
Зарегистрирован: Вт ноя 14, 2006 11:05 pm

Сообщение Artemyi »

Мб так

Код: Выделить всё

location not comodo, beach_dun03, cmd_fild01, beach_dun3
Lolo
Начинающий
Сообщения: 32
Зарегистрирован: Ср май 21, 2008 9:20 pm

Сообщение Lolo »

Точно там без нолика.. :crazy: :oops: Спасибо ^_^ Но осталась вторая проблема... Дохнет при входе в игру.. Может из за этого? (Your Coordinates: 67, 157)

Код: Выделить всё

connected
You are now in the game
Your Coordinates: 67, 157
[macro] automacro die triggered.

PvP Display Mode
You are now: Pecopeco
Item Appeared: Skull (0) x 1 (67, 156)
Sound alert: death
You have died
You've died.
Map Change: comodo.gat (204, 143)
[macro] automacro healer triggered.
Calculating route to: Beach town,Comodo(comodo): 188, 162
PvP Display Mode
Artemyi
Энтузиаст
Сообщения: 61
Зарегистрирован: Вт ноя 14, 2006 11:05 pm

Сообщение Artemyi »

Точно там без нолика..
Тогда так

Код: Выделить всё

location not comodo, cmd_fild01, beach_dun3
Чтоб лишнего не было


з.ы. на какой локе он у тебя в игру входит? Если на локе, которой нет в списке, то само собой.
Lolo
Начинающий
Сообщения: 32
Зарегистрирован: Ср май 21, 2008 9:20 pm

Сообщение Lolo »

Все равно дохнет при входе в игру и при переходе на beach_dun3(насчет бич данжа я ошибся в своем прошлом посте...у меня тогда просто был звук отключен) умирают они всего 2 раза..Напрягает больше всего то что у меня дофига ботов из за этого приходиться ждать пока каждый умрет..ибо они юзат @gstorage(жосско тупят когда другой согильдиец его открывает) при смерти

Код: Выделить всё

automacro die {
location not comodo, cmd_fild01, beach_dun3
call die1
run-once 1
}

macro die1 {
do c @die
pause 1
release die
}
>Перса оставлял на cmd_fild01 потом зашел ботом..

You are now in the game
Your Coordinates: 345, 228
[macro] automacro die triggered.

OpenKore 2.0.6 SVN6317

У меня такое чувство что это не излечимо (
Lolo
Начинающий
Сообщения: 32
Зарегистрирован: Ср май 21, 2008 9:20 pm

Сообщение Lolo »

Совсем не излечимо чтоль? :(
Ответить